2024 ผู้เขียน: Elizabeth Oswald | [email protected]. แก้ไขล่าสุด: 2024-01-13 00:13
การแบ่งหน้า API เป็นสิ่งจำเป็นหากคุณกำลังจัดการกับ ข้อมูลจำนวนมากและจุดสิ้นสุด การแบ่งหน้าหมายถึงการเพิ่มลำดับให้กับผลลัพธ์ของคิวรีโดยอัตโนมัติ รหัสวัตถุเป็นผลลัพธ์เริ่มต้น แต่สามารถเรียงลำดับผลลัพธ์ด้วยวิธีอื่นได้เช่นกัน
จุดประสงค์ของการแบ่งหน้าคืออะไร
ดังนั้น การแบ่งหน้าทำหน้าที่เป็น ตัวแบ่งหน้า ให้ผู้ใช้พิจารณาการย้ายครั้งต่อไปและให้วิธีการในการข้ามจากรายการชุดหนึ่งไปยังอีกชุดหนึ่ง รายการหมายเลขในรูปแบบการแบ่งหน้ายังทำให้ผู้ใช้ระบุได้ว่ายังมีหน้าอื่นๆ เหลือให้ตรวจสอบอีกกี่หน้า
การแบ่งหน้า REST API คืออะไร
มีการใช้ชื่อหลายชื่อในอุตสาหกรรมสำหรับปลายทางที่ return ชุดที่มีเลขหน้า โดยเฉพาะอย่างยิ่งใน REST APIS เช่น ทรัพยากรการรวบรวม รายการปลายทาง จุดสิ้นสุดดัชนี ฯลฯ … ฉัน ฉันจะตั้งชื่อมันว่า "รายการปลายทาง" ตลอดทั้งเอกสาร
การตอบสนองการแบ่งหน้าคืออะไร
การแบ่งหน้าใน Square API
ในปลายทาง Square API ผลลัพธ์ที่มีการแบ่งหน้าจะมี เคอร์เซอร์ฟิลด์ ซึ่งเป็นส่วนหนึ่งของเนื้อหาการตอบสนอง หากต้องการดึงผลลัพธ์ชุดถัดไป ให้ส่งคำขอติดตามผลไปยังปลายทางเดียวกันและระบุค่าเคอร์เซอร์ที่ส่งคืนในการตอบกลับก่อนหน้าเป็นพารามิเตอร์การค้นหา
การแบ่งหน้าควรเป็นอย่างไร
แนวทางปฏิบัติที่ดีของการออกแบบการแบ่งหน้า
- ให้พื้นที่คลิกขนาดใหญ่
- อย่าใช้ขีดเส้นใต้
- ระบุหน้าปัจจุบัน
- เว้นวรรคลิงค์
- ให้ลิงก์ก่อนหน้าและถัดไป
- ใช้ลิงค์แรกและลิงค์สุดท้าย (ถ้ามี)
- ใส่ลิงค์แรกและลิงค์สุดท้ายที่ด้านนอก
แนะนำ:
Redux หรือ Context api ไหนดีกว่ากัน?
Context API ใช้งานง่ายเพราะมีช่วงการเรียนรู้สั้น มันต้องการโค้ดน้อยกว่า และเนื่องจากไม่ต้องการไลบรารี่เพิ่มเติม ขนาดบันเดิลจึงลดลง ในทางกลับกัน Redux ต้องการการเพิ่มไลบรารี่เพิ่มเติมในกลุ่มแอปพลิเคชัน วากยสัมพันธ์ซับซ้อนและกว้างขวาง สร้างงานที่ไม่จำเป็นและซับซ้อน บริบท API จะแทนที่ Redux หรือไม่ React Context API เป็นวิธีการจัดการสถานะของ React ในหลายองค์ประกอบที่ไม่ได้เชื่อมต่อโดยตรง หากไม่มี Hooks Context API อาจดูเหมือนไม่มากนักเมื่อเทียบกับ Redux แต่เมื่อรวมกับ use
ควรใช้ api stress zyme เมื่อใด
คุณอาจใช้น้ำยาทำความสะอาดแบคทีเรีย API MARINE STRESS ZYME ทุกสัปดาห์ แต่โดยเฉพาะอย่างยิ่ง ทุกครั้งที่คุณทำการเปลี่ยนน้ำ 25% ในตู้ปลาของคุณ เพื่อทดแทนแบคทีเรียที่เป็นประโยชน์ เพื่อให้แน่ใจว่าวงจรในตู้ปลาของคุณยังคงทำงานได้ตามปกติสำหรับปลาของคุณ ฉันควรใช้ API Stress Zyme บ่อยแค่ไหน ทิศทาง: